

About the company
Minor Punctuations Theatre is a Toronto-based contemporary theatre company dedicated to playwriting, performance, and the creation of original theatre and performance productions. Working across workshops and full productions, the company supports emerging and early-career artists and creates space for new work to develop between text, body, and presence.
Founded by playwright and theatre-maker Aylin Oyan Salahshoor, the company is shaped by diasporic ways of working—where language carries memory, displacement informs form, and making work is both an artistic and political act. These perspectives inform Minor Punctuations’ commitment to process, care, and experimentation.

Upcoming Show
Far Flung Peoples
Far Flung Peoples is a new creation by Minor Punctuations Theatre, premiering at Theatre Centre in October 2026.
In a shared space that is never quite home, four lives collide. They wait. They argue. They misunderstand one another. They laugh at the wrong moments and sometimes at themselves. Between paperwork, shared meals, and long silences, comedy slips in not as escape, but as survival.
Through multilingual dialogue, physical presence, and ensemble driven performance, Far Flung Peoples moves between humour and vulnerability, tracing the absurdities and tenderness of displacement. Everyday frustrations become comic rhythms. Memory interrupts the present. Imagination stretches reality just enough to make it bearable.
Far Flung Peoples invites audiences to laugh, to recognize themselves, and to sit with uncertainty, asking what it means to live together when home is provisional, language is unstable, and the future remains unresolved.

The Playwriting Lab is a development space dedicated to supporting new writing and emerging voices. Selected participants have the opportunity to workshop their scripts, receive feedback from artists and collaborators, and take part in readings or creative development sessions. Information about application periods, eligibility, and submission guidelines will be announced on our website and Instagram page.
